From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from shymkent.ilbers.de ([unix socket]) by shymkent (Cyrus 2.5.10-Debian-2.5.10-3+deb9u2) with LMTPA; Wed, 28 Jan 2026 12:54:41 +0100 X-Sieve: CMU Sieve 2.4 Received: from mail-lf1-f62.google.com (mail-lf1-f62.google.com [209.85.167.62]) by shymkent.ilbers.de (8.15.2/8.15.2/Debian-8+deb9u1) with ESMTPS id 60SBsejM010424 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T) for ; Wed, 28 Jan 2026 12:54:41 +0100 Received: by mail-lf1-f62.google.com with SMTP id 2adb3069b0e04-59b6a9bf5cbsf4597980e87.2 for ; Wed, 28 Jan 2026 03:54:41 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1769601275; cv=pass; d=google.com; s=arc-20240605; b=NDg2O81UNfKgwummgfvV9licNnGWPqa/44iz7PnByhEf/VNZrnVLRzt+8MJNuov02l +YQ22ySQsjDGrJV5F6Re3v7XabRwpABdCt4lHa56kDRYRQYuckQC6MCXMfmpDZf5MwjJ TciEx+EknPx0PspcywILqSVqqLcJAAOjLhbrwcbymOwLpu9152Rr1HwqaOULj0RbxbPC gStizyppJWPW75nRZr5kP1ezeUUJhrWr2hjtbWfBI1/07gzoXCNpy2UTl9q+YVULM9LE Wj5irEfeMXqBumVmCpVzH4lQJ7KiT1FuVehMjWUdlrMCug0i+W/s1KzqXrhuU9rRiGk0 Qe5Q==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post :list-id:mailing-list:precedence: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:sender:dkim-signature; bh=K/Ym0os8rWUGaPmkHJqi/YOY4qn2fkjpncH7nLepkFk=; fh=W53boCQvUrWcu4YQSbomUDHXh9pJs3hQ5pb76sfkM+w=; b=NAwE182spotjWrh3mJWfkySaZa6JOJzjGelYwkffTmGUzBg7C/P+dwDu0g9GXbCCl9 x9/QyWmMuiP1+NYuwPUlwA9gjtlfi/HBvPUyQXEcsM3IhIKCxS2CxpEVHRflzkC/0fH4 MLkmBRfz2RsN/UqNr5kKUi5Ugxw+71lJz2FUYQVv3RjJdQWjl/NqCRqCFxl5GEicOZCq UGN0BVypKZ8yDnetFX3AG+wL54j0MPYSwT63CT/YK1aTQ7wa0wcFQYrZtpRKSwjcbYFA hf3ZyX2C7j2Rm+EFVwNiC0XT+ULzFZ+WV/dh5HNRseZC+KePpJJ8NefyYiGRHy3CkYaG /ARg==; darn=ilbers.de ARC-Authentication-Results: i=2; gmr-mx.google.com; spf=pass (google.com: domain of wzh@ilbers.de designates 85.214.156.166 as permitted sender) smtp.mailfrom=wzh@ilbers.de D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legroups.com; s=20230601; t=1769601275; x=1770206075; darn=ilbers.de; h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post :list-id:mailing-list:precedence:x-original-authentication-results :x-original-sender:in-reply-to:from:content-language:references:cc :to:subject:user-agent:mime-version:date:message-id:sender:from:to :cc:subject:date:message-id:reply-to; bh=K/Ym0os8rWUGaPmkHJqi/YOY4qn2fkjpncH7nLepkFk=; b=bOwBv5vVsY3M3mu999uQt/gB4NbVN6GmrNepFV+QYORlCbJmVNvMvyZC7R2eLUIewH ynhsuG2w42invOqQIfADyklIFa82k34l8LQORjSDuCjeRPjI4YNuawGIFBAMz4dZjzMc 9EUey0jF5Vnu7c7jV4oI681gdRCfPFdFhl/T7iM8qJXtYOzFVIQ13u8upo0IPkolU3ix oo+aWf5a7FbsUvk0KHdKZpTEvZED5/avue10te806pls+OAVz0I1wkruCMVzyO/RX9HP MGtUtOydxPbuxsuL7/L16Gqs8Ubec6MR30ioJ+WSAo54LHKFrLfiotPZ6st+Sem3kVps DunA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1769601275; x=1770206075; h=list-unsubscribe:list-subscribe:list-archive:list-help:list-post :x-spam-checked-in-group:list-id:mailing-list:precedence :x-original-authentication-results:x-original-sender:in-reply-to :from:content-language:references:cc:to:subject:user-agent :mime-version:date:message-id:x-beenthere:x-gm-message-state:sender :from:to:cc:subject:date:message-id:reply-to; bh=K/Ym0os8rWUGaPmkHJqi/YOY4qn2fkjpncH7nLepkFk=; b=Qw+oLC9ZMkm3a+lfMXlm1NNwvP7BWB1pqLFwxVbL7YUQBVn2WEr+1H4hZSr69gK7dy 67yzng0ecaytnaljsD4Iy4xjSRbqngCTFsB1WQWKnDFwgGnUXPJ8LKv/qBf1T27fsmDx mSFoS6FT2RgfgvyLiTUq+SWkgwpv9L8/tBYtUrsyZLmUbGDM44psN51WzWACpN/zGS4F xxGrKpkD3mg4b2IGStdZhdzn1lCW2uUiN4YVjjS61Q130eDmCxau5z3wulsqdDy0Obnf 6tG+Tler4RFhqrm+Y6+cb/kfTE8uDrvNkiN7y8hUcjvA+bUdM5c3Qr/BurrgfIqLtSHf a6BQ== Sender: isar-users@googlegroups.com X-Forwarded-Encrypted: i=2; AJvYcCXXbWcW/8SQBBIzXhdxypkeqjXupNXuluJGc7yLIauOIfTrqFJ4SO8AaYoSodIc01pxPI6g@ilbers.de X-Gm-Message-State: AOJu0Yy66SO/idrhkdQlj1k2Ig3L4kNVxJC7uc8Ac6V43HTZ9VZCIh9y tPj454/OvdFRVuc7RqiW94OlQ/rdbI46dilTStW++EuvwVqJekL8XBBy X-Received: by 2002:a05:6512:10d2:b0:59d:e77e:adb4 with SMTP id 2adb3069b0e04-59e040253acmr2165034e87.29.1769601274962; Wed, 28 Jan 2026 03:54:34 -0800 (PST) X-BeenThere: isar-users@googlegroups.com; h="AV1CL+EJvoARsG1oiGHdw1EhGO0TwzHcG/6tDnK0kwtexjBDGg==" Received: by 2002:a05:6512:1055:b0:59b:7205:469d with SMTP id 2adb3069b0e04-59dd79861bdls3269911e87.2.-pod-prod-06-eu; Wed, 28 Jan 2026 03:54:32 -0800 (PST) X-Received: by 2002:a05:6512:3087:b0:59b:b037:489e with SMTP id 2adb3069b0e04-59e04011b75mr2041462e87.4.1769601272123; Wed, 28 Jan 2026 03:54:32 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1769601272; cv=none; d=google.com; s=arc-20240605; b=g9bWgwa7hvoxbfNtHzf+pF68CiMH3ODxQswnCmHkIxWrvv95YroK6UUywpJ4ZbQm1q C3qagu53se2NFwczXNsW3mKryrir0ZEaWY35vlYZnnv8ndvGjfPvX6BjW8AxjRMxJMlQ 7Omk9s6jQEEBkEqXfw1bXMq0QlUpqBpMvCA0zbCxT//LMv1A+2GUf56iKMjdwEjMLsiG tC9K1Zn7nJS2kn65nf43A5zTab4RXGB0MbGherM98rfRJt9XxDm/f/TMjeGueVjRBUWV ex7ie7J69JWMehGh7afPBf//5cgyn5dFDChRC4DOvwvcFFndBGoxgB+C3O981UG5ouq8 2nww==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id; bh=EcC64uGdXyRvSLhh61jnLXZTejJaT9GLwHD8RLMTE5U=; fh=C37l5vGm7U2eZ/l7+t9CMsA78Do2Rg4OXXyzPhO3+tA=; b=gyDVIgkBe128kgymWVny/5+4hf1OhlsgtdHbr6bjuH7iw6zYCc8TwMyr6hQtLMEp2i swYhvH2Xi3Bc2biUE5dMIQdfSnBaaPnyD1st2YvVQkreZl1xGwMk4IWRvtPAM3LpbJPP djuPjtfssIeXNM+kJCd+gXOt/hJeml0MSP5p1rNgqbKQ47bbElo9KvFCIL11dbURD4VL 56HUpGZDSbg2fd8xRntnwjKn5CWpP01jeBu148um+beywCkyiaCgu6tpOlX55NPpQC7C BML09cOi7P7Nl9GAI0m+UOdHwbvsnrlmRmwnadIkdxabQnM6NcPFYzISXH/L/B4zi2An BJBw==; dara=google.com ARC-Authentication-Results: i=1; gmr-mx.google.com; spf=pass (google.com: domain of wzh@ilbers.de designates 85.214.156.166 as permitted sender) smtp.mailfrom=wzh@ilbers.de Received: from shymkent.ilbers.de (shymkent.ilbers.de. [85.214.156.166]) by gmr-mx.google.com with ESMTPS id 2adb3069b0e04-59e0748cc00si52954e87.1.2026.01.28.03.54.31 for (version=TLS1_2 cipher=ECDHE-ECDSA-CHACHA20-POLY1305 bits=256/256); Wed, 28 Jan 2026 03:54:31 -0800 (PST) Received-SPF: pass (google.com: domain of wzh@ilbers.de designates 85.214.156.166 as permitted sender) client-ip=85.214.156.166; Received: from [192.168.178.117] ([88.130.203.42]) (authenticated bits=0) by shymkent.ilbers.de (8.15.2/8.15.2/Debian-8+deb9u1) with ESMTPSA id 60SBsUBM010412 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Wed, 28 Jan 2026 12:54:30 +0100 Message-ID: <22e10b87-7601-47aa-a4be-b0ec6eb785bf@ilbers.de> Date: Wed, 28 Jan 2026 12:54:30 +0100 M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H v3 17/20] testsuite: skip VM tests if images are not available To: isar-users@googlegroups.com, felix.moessbauer@siemens.com, amikan@ilbers.de Cc: cedric.hombourger@siemens.com References: <20260123082501.240751-1-wzh@ilbers.de> <20260123082501.240751-18-wzh@ilbers.de> Content-Language: en-US From: Zhihang Wei In-Reply-To: <20260123082501.240751-18-wzh@ilbers.de> Content-Type: text/plain; charset="UTF-8"; format=flowed X-Spam-Status: No, score=-4.6 required=5.0 tests=DKIMWL_WL_MED,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_EF,HEADER_FROM_DIFFERENT_DOMAINS, MAILING_LIST_MULTI,RCVD_IN_DNSWL_BLOCKED,RCVD_IN_MSPIKE_H2, RCVD_IN_RP_CERTIFIED,RCVD_IN_RP_RNBL,RCVD_IN_RP_SAFE,SPF_PASS autolearn=unavailable autolearn_force=no version=3.4.2 X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on shymkent.ilbers.de X-Original-Sender: wzh@ilbers.de X-Original-Authentication-Results: gmr-mx.google.com; spf=pass (google.com: domain of wzh@ilbers.de designates 85.214.156.166 as permitted sender) smtp.mailfrom=wzh@ilbers.de Precedence: list Mailing-list: list isar-users@googlegroups.com; contact isar-users+owners@googlegroups.com List-ID: X-Spam-Checked-In-Group: isar-users@googlegroups.com X-Google-Group-Id: 914930254986 List-Post: , List-Help: , List-Archive: , List-Unsubscribe: , X-TUID: tciqTdfDUBFS On 1/23/26 09:24, Zhihang Wei wrote: > From: "MOESSBAUER, Felix" > > We currently fail the test if the image is not available. Instead, we > now skip it and report what is missing. By that, we stay semantically > correct by not failing tests when pre-conditions are not fulfilled. > > Signed-off-by: Felix Moessbauer > --- > testsuite/cibuilder.py | 19 +++++++++++++++++++ > 1 file changed, 19 insertions(+) > > diff --git a/testsuite/cibuilder.py b/testsuite/cibuilder.py > index 7538ade2..6faa9038 100755 > --- a/testsuite/cibuilder.py > +++ b/testsuite/cibuilder.py > @@ -24,6 +24,7 @@ from utils import CIUtils > from avocado import Test > from avocado.utils import path > from avocado.utils import process > +from avocado.core import exceptions > > sys.path.append(os.path.join(os.path.dirname(__file__), '../bitbake/lib')) > > @@ -703,6 +704,7 @@ class CIBuilder(Test): > keep=False, > ): > time_to_wait = self.params.get('time_to_wait', default=DEF_VM_TO_SEC) > + self.skip_if_vm_image_missing(arch, distro, image) > > self.log.info("===================================================") > self.log.info(f"Running Isar VM boot test for ({distro}-{arch})") > @@ -800,3 +802,20 @@ class CIBuilder(Test): > self.vm_turn_off(vm) > > return stdout, stderr > + > + def skip_if_vm_image_missing(self, arch, distro, image): > + ( > + image_fstypes, > + image_fullname, > + deploy_dir_image, > + ) = CIUtils.getVars( > + 'IMAGE_FSTYPES', > + 'IMAGE_FULLNAME', > + 'DEPLOY_DIR_IMAGE', > + target=f"mc:qemu{arch}-{distro}:{image}", > + ) > + image_type = image_fstypes.split()[0] > + rootfs_image = f"{image_fullname}.{image_type}" > + rootfs_image_path = os.path.join(deploy_dir_image, rootfs_image) > + if not os.path.exists(rootfs_image_path): > + raise exceptions.TestSkipError(f'VM image missing: {rootfs_image}') Hi, this particular patch (p17) causes Avocado to crash because it encounters an unrecognized log level. This is a known issue in Avocado that has been fixed in more recent versions. While we plan to update Avocado on our CI server, we would prefer to partially apply the patch set without p17 for now, as that patch is quite independent of the others. Zhihang -- You received this message because you are subscribed to the Google Groups "isar-users" group. To unsubscribe from this group and stop receiving emails from it, send an email to isar-users+unsubscribe@googlegroups.com. To view this discussion visit https://groups.google.com/d/msgid/isar-users/22e10b87-7601-47aa-a4be-b0ec6eb785bf%40ilbers.de.